In LESSONS FROM THE HEART OF AMERICAN BUSINESS Greenwald shares his insights and experiences on the most pressing issues in business today: an aging workforce, corporate ethics, dealing with layoffs. Building trust with employees, office politics and much more.

Refreshing, down-to-earth and right on the money, Gerald Greenwald tells it like it is when it comes to grappling with industry problems in the USA - and what you can do about it. Greenwald has help top management positions at a number of major companies including Chrysler, Ford and United Airlines but despite his lofty jobs he's never lost sight of how business works on an everyday basis.

Building on his own Midwestern background, Greenwald presents a rolled-up sleeves strategy that makes all American workers think hard about where they've been and where they're going.
